Tissuemed praised in Clinical paper
Clinical evidence published in the British Journal of Neurosurgery reveals TissuePatchDural - a surgical product developed and manufactured by Leeds based Tissuemed – prevents leaks during surgery, reduces surgery time and offers clinicians improves results.

Monocon steels itself for US growth with funding
Yorkshire manufacturing and engineering company Monocon International Refractories is set to make two acquisitions in the US after receiving £6.4m of funding.
